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,589,407
Lastest Block:
1,963,563
Utxos:
1,983,813
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
19/08/2025 07:03:28 UTC
Txid
5b675b0c52bfed61019a3b8c067a65350482ed94bd05f0be25aea9d069939da8
Block
1,832,453
Block hash
8f2303dd3b7d2638c80bb5f9624d4d1f55bcdc3b526d331441f4fa44d8050f45
Stake amount
172.26082137 XEP
Sender
ep1qpf9wv08ejwkr3nqf23pcltccvhu8agdmnr8dvg
Recipient
ep1qve595yzfr9henyp2uxf9jmhwnhpnkur7a3mcla
(3,489,098.74209018 XEP)